Why High Temperatures Make Food Storage Difficult
When outdoor temperatures rise, refrigerators must work significantly harder to maintain internal cooling. Every time the fridge door is opened, warm air enters and forces the system to recover quickly. In extreme heat, this constant pressure can lead to uneven cooling, especially if the fridge is overpacked or poorly organized.
Perishable foods such as meat, dairy, and seafood are particularly sensitive to temperature changes. Even short periods of exposure to higher temperatures can accelerate spoilage, making proper fridge management essential during summer travel.
Understanding Safe Temperature Ranges
To ensure food safety, fresh items should be stored between 32°F and 40°F (0°C to 4°C). This range slows bacterial growth while maintaining freshness for daily consumption. Frozen foods should ideally be kept at 0°F (-18°C) to ensure long-term preservation.
While most modern refrigerators can reach these temperatures, maintaining stability in outdoor conditions is where performance differences become important. This is especially true for campers and RV users who rely on alternative energy sources.

Smart Habits for Better Cooling Performance
Temperature settings alone are not enough to ensure food safety. User habits also play a major role in maintaining efficiency. For example, minimizing how often the fridge door is opened helps reduce temperature fluctuations. Pre-cooling food before storage can also ease the workload on the fridge.
Proper organization is equally important. Leaving enough space between items allows cold air to circulate evenly, preventing warm spots inside the fridge. Overloading should be avoided, especially during peak summer heat when cooling systems are already under pressure.
